Output 17c305c24bb9d2fc852e2036b6c5bdde5ab300235007ebde63efa78a7f1aa1b9:0

value
4331429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e1be3568a72f494babd0838ae6f773c07b8eafa OP_EQUAL
address
37MRE8cu5poo65o3spPN9Us5h8HigcPiym
transaction
17c305c24bb9d2fc852e2036b6c5bdde5ab300235007ebde63efa78a7f1aa1b9
confirmations
491957
spent
true